前言
作为一个Linux系统管理员,我们经常需要在服务器上进行图形化操作,这时候就需要安装一些图形界面库,其中GTK是一个重要的图形界面库。本文将详细介绍如何在CentOS上安装GTK。
什么是GTK?
GTK是GIMP Toolkit的缩写,是一种用于创建图形用户界面(GUI)的自由软件库。GTK最初是为GIMP(GNU Image Manipulation Program)开发的,但现在已经成为Linux桌面环境的重要组成部分,被用于开发许多流行的应用程序,如Gnome桌面环境、Pidgin、GIMP、Inkscape等。
如何安装GTK?
在CentOS上安装GTK非常简单,只需要执行以下命令:
```
sudo yum install gtk2-devel
这个命令将会安装GTK2的开发库,包括必要的依赖关系。如果您需要安装GTK3,请执行以下命令:
sudo yum install gtk3-devel
安装完成后,您就可以在您的程序中使用GTK了。
如何使用GTK?
如果您希望在C语言程序中使用GTK,您需要包含gtk.h头文件,并链接libgtk-x11-2.0.so和libgdk-x11-2.0.so库。下面是一个简单的GTK程序:
```c
#include
int main(int argc, char *argv[]) {
GtkWidget *window;
gtk_init(&argc, &argv);
window = gtk_window_new(GTK_WINDOW_TOPLEVEL);
gtk_widget_show(window);
gtk_main();
return 0;
}
如果您希望使用其他语言,如Python或Vala,您可以使用相应的GTK绑定库。
总结
本文介绍了如何在CentOS上安装GTK,并简要介绍了如何使用GTK。如果您希望深入了解GTK,您可以查看GTK官方文档。
小知识分享
在Ubuntu中,您可以使用Ctrl+Alt+T快捷键打开终端。